What is a Proprietary Trading Platform?
A proprietary trading platform is a specialized software system developed by financial institutions or trading firms to facilitate trading in financial markets. Unlike retail trading platforms, which are often off-the-shelf products, proprietary platforms are designed to meet unique operational and trading requirements. These platforms enable traders to execute complex strategies and manage assets efficiently.
Key Differences Between Proprietary and Retail Trading Platforms
Understanding the difference between proprietary and retail trading platforms is essential for any trader. Here are some key distinctions:
- Customization: Proprietary platforms offer tailored features specifically designed for the firm's trading strategies.
- Transaction Speed: They typically provide faster execution speeds, essential for high-frequency trading.
- Data Management: Enhanced data analytics capabilities allow firms to leverage market trends.
- Cost Structure: Proprietary platforms usually involve higher initial development costs but can lead to significant long-term savings.
Benefits of Proprietary Trading Platforms
Choosing to use a proprietary trading platform comes with numerous advantages that can significantly improve trading performance:
1. Enhanced Performance and Speed
Proprietary trading platforms are engineered to ensure optimal performance. With advanced algorithms and direct market access, these platforms help traders achieve faster execution times, which is crucial in volatile markets.
2. Advanced Analytical Tools
One of the standout features of proprietary platforms is their superior analytical capabilities. Users have access to various tools that can analyze market data, predict trends, and generate insights that traditional platforms may not offer.
3. Customizable User Experience
Customization is a hallmark of proprietary trading platforms. Firms can tailor the interface, functionality, and tools to suit the specific needs of their traders, allowing for enhanced user engagement and productivity.
4. Improved Risk Management
Robust risk management features enable traders to set limits, create stop-loss orders, and utilize scenario analysis tools to protect their investments. This attention to risk helps firms mitigate potential losses.
Key Features of Proprietary Trading Platforms
When evaluating a proprietary trading platform, several key features should be considered:
1. Real-time Market Data
Access to real-time data feeds is crucial for making informed trading decisions. Proprietary platforms often integrate multiple data sources, ensuring that traders work with the most current information available.
2. Automated Trading Capabilities
Many proprietary platforms support algorithmic trading, allowing traders to implement automated strategies based on predefined criteria. This feature can free up time and reduce emotional decision-making.
3. Comprehensive Reporting Tools
Advanced reporting tools enable traders to generate detailed performance reports, track transactions, and analyze costs. Such insights are invaluable for evaluating strategies and improving performance.
4. User-Friendly Interface
A user-friendly interface is essential for efficiency and productivity. Proprietary trading platforms prioritize ease of use, with intuitive navigation and streamlined workflows to support traders at all levels.
